CleverMax Promotes RFID Hanger Systems for Textile Production

Published: May 28, 2026
Author: HFT

RFID-enabled automation and overhead logistics systems target efficiency gains in textile production

Nantong Mingxing Technology Development Co., Ltd., operating under the CleverMax brand, has outlined its intelligent hanger system technologies designed for home textile and garment manufacturing environments.

The company stated that changing consumer demand for higher product variety and shorter delivery timelines is accelerating the shift away from conventional floor-based production systems toward automated manufacturing models.

CleverMax positions its Intelligent Home Textile Hanger System as an integrated production management platform combining robotics, RFID technology, overhead conveyor systems, and software algorithms to automate material transportation between workstations.

The company said the system aligns with manufacturing concepts commonly used in the textile automation industry, including Unit Production Systems, One-Piece Flow, RFID-based production informatization, IoT data integration, real-time production monitoring, intelligent logistics, and smart storage and sorting.

According to the company, traditional textile facilities often face operational challenges including floor congestion, high levels of work-in-process inventory, and manual material handling. CleverMax said its overhead conveyor-based logistics system moves textile components above the production floor, reclaiming usable factory space while reducing fabric creasing, handling damage, and contamination risks.

The company stated that its sixth-generation intelligent hanger technology supports a transition from conventional bundle-based production systems to a Unit Production System (UPS) using One-Piece Flow operations. Under this approach, individual textile items are transported independently between workstations based on real-time production capacity.

CleverMax claims the system reduces non-productive handling time and can contribute to overall efficiency gains of approximately 15% to 20% by allowing operators to focus primarily on sewing operations rather than material movement and sorting.

The company also highlighted integration between its hanger systems, Manufacturing Execution Systems (MES), and the CM Industrial Internet Platform, developed in partnership with the Institute of Software and the Institute of Automation at the Chinese Academy of Sciences.

Using RFID-enabled “Clever Nodes,” the system captures real-time production data at each workstation to create what the company describes as a digital twin of the factory floor. This enables monitoring of production flow, bottleneck detection, and automated piece-rate calculations.

CleverMax further stated that its Flexible Mixed-Flow Production Scheduling System allows multiple textile styles and product types to be processed simultaneously on a single production line. Intelligent hangers are programmed to route products only through required workstations based on individual production requirements.

The company said the technology is intended to support manufacturers managing small-batch, multi-style production environments common in contemporary e-commerce and customised home textile sectors.

According to CleverMax, manufacturers implementing intelligent hanger systems may achieve labour cost reductions of around 10%, alongside reduced work-in-process inventory and improved production consistency.

The company reports holding 20 invention patents and 28 utility model patents and states that it has served more than 6,000 customers, including Mercury Home Textiles.
